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5676012 666576 431 71
3499512 4044245 10501920
3499512 4044245 10501920
3788042 28 4022550871
All about undefined
Interested in learning more?
3499512 4044245 10501920
3788042 28 4022550871
See more
718724737 089882181
85 9984414 005 0263
See more
25 00 15967
4688883496 397598383 82543
See more